Eddie Higgins, a seasoned jazz pianist, presents "It's Magic Vol. 1," a captivating album released in 2007 under Venus Records, Inc. This vinyl and CD release is a delightful collection of seven timeless jazz standards, each beautifully reinterpreted by Higgins and his collaborators, Scott Hamilton and Ken Peplowski. The album spans a concise yet engaging 40 minutes, offering a rich and immersive listening experience.
The tracklist features classic tunes such as "It's Magic," "Ghost of a Chance," and "Autumn Leaves," showcasing Higgins' mastery of the genre and his ability to infuse each piece with a unique charm. The album's title track, "It's Magic," sets the tone with its enchanting melody, while "I Got It Bad (And That Ain't Good)" and "Moon Indigo" highlight the trio's exceptional chemistry and musical prowess.
Originally released in South Korea and later reissued in Japan, "It's Magic Vol. 1" has garnered critical acclaim and a dedicated following among jazz enthusiasts.
